package org.smallmind.web.reverse;
import java.io.IOException;
import java.io.OutputStream;
import java.util.regex.Matcher;
import java.util.regex.Pattern;
import org.smallmind.nutsnbolts.http.HttpMethod;
public class HttpRequestFrame extends HttpFrame {
private static final Pattern REQUEST_LINE_PATTERN = Pattern.compile("([A-Z]+)\\s+(.+)\\s+HTTP/(\\d+\\.\\d+)");
private HttpMethod method;
private String path;
public HttpRequestFrame (HttpProtocolInputStream httpProtocolInputStream)
throws IOException, ProtocolException {
this(httpProtocolInputStream, parseRequestLine(httpProtocolInputStream.readLine()));
}
private HttpRequestFrame (HttpProtocolInputStream inputStream, Matcher matcher)
throws IOException, ProtocolException {
super(inputStream, matcher.group(3));
try {
method = HttpMethod.valueOf(matcher.group(1));
} catch (Exception exception) {
throw new ProtocolException(CannedResponse.BAD_REQUEST);
}
path = matcher.group(2);
}
private static Matcher parseRequestLine (String line)
throws ProtocolException {
Matcher matcher;
if (!(matcher = REQUEST_LINE_PATTERN.matcher(line)).matches()) {
throw new ProtocolException(CannedResponse.BAD_REQUEST);
}
return matcher;
}
@Override
public HttpDirection getDirection () {
return HttpDirection.REQUEST;
}
public HttpMethod getMethod () {
return method;
}
public String getPath () {
return path;
}
public void toOutputStream (OutputStream outputStream)
throws IOException {
outputStream.write(getMethod().name().getBytes());
outputStream.write(' ');
outputStream.write(getPath().getBytes());
outputStream.write(" HTTP/".getBytes());
outputStream.write(getVersion().getBytes());
outputStream.write("\r\n".getBytes());
for (HttpHeader header : getHeaders()) {
int valueIndex = 0;
outputStream.write(header.getName().getBytes());
outputStream.write(": ".getBytes());
for (String value : header.getValues()) {
if (valueIndex++ > 0) {
outputStream.write(", ".getBytes());
}
outputStream.write(value.getBytes());
}
outputStream.write("\r\n".getBytes());
}
outputStream.write("\r\n".getBytes());
}
}
